Ponagar Festival opens in Khanh Hoa

The 2010 Goddess Ponagar Festival opened in Nha Trang city of the south central province of Khanh Hoa on May 5, attracting more than 5,000 pilgrims of 100 delegations from surrounding provinces. 

According to the province’s relic and landscape management centre, the Festival is the biggest religious festival held from the 21st to 25th day of the third lunar month every year to commemorate the Goddess Thien Y A Na – Holy Mother of the Cham community in the central region. 

At the opening ceremony, various traditional dances of Cham people were performed to honour the beauty of the Cham culture. 

Earlier, on the night of May 3, more than 7,000 flower garlands and coloured lanterns were released from 22 boats to the Cai river near the foot of the Ponagar Tower to pray for people and soldiers who had laid down for the cause of national construction and defence.
